E-learning platform ABA English raises $12 million to continue its international growth

ABA English, an online language learning platform, has raised $12 million in funding from Kennet Partners and Nauta Capital.

The Barcelona e-learning company provides video-based English language lessons via mobile and web. It has 10 million users globally and counts a number of big firms among its client base, including Ikea and Kraft Foods.

ABA English is currently available in over 170 countries and is setting its sights on further internationalisation, namely in China and Turkey. Earlier this month it signed an agreement with Cambridge English Language Assessment that certifies its lessons.

“Kennet’s investment will take us to the next level, not only by encouraging consumers to learn English but also by helping us to become the key training partner for organizations around the world,” said Javier Figarola, CEO of ABA English.

“We have been extremely impressed with the way in which ABA English has been able to grow rapidly despite limited capital resources,” said Hillel Zidel, managing director of Kennet Partners. “Its core users are strongly engaged with the platform, a testament to the quality of ABA’s product and the tangible benefits that learning English brings to its customers.”

Zidel will be joining the board at ABA English. Former CEO of Trovit Iñaki Ecenarro, another investor in the company, is also joining the company’s board.
